Two sisters have teamed up to open a new aesthetics clinic in the heart of Hale village.
Dr Caroline Warden, an NHS GP with over 17 years of medical experience, and her sister Louise Devereux have officially unveiled their newly refurbished clinic, Dr. Caroline Warden Aesthetics, at 2 Crown Passages.
What began as a modest operation from a single rented room in Wilmslow has blossomed into a sophisticated clinic offering evidence-based skin treatments.
"We believe in helping you feel like the best version of yourself," said Dr Warden, who holds a Level 7 postgraduate diploma in cosmetic injectables from London's prestigious Harley Academy.

"Our aim isn’t just to treat the surface, but to improve skin health at a deeper level - always with safety and integrity at the heart of everything we do.”
The clinic offers bespoke treatment plans following an in-depth dermatological assessment.
“Skincare can be overwhelming for people,” added Caroline. “Most clients come in with a concern but aren’t sure how to treat it. We take the time to understand their needs and create a written treatment plan. It’s all about offering honest advice and real solutions.”
Co-founder Louise Devereux, the clinic’s Creative Director and Patient Co-ordinator, said: “After my own journey with skin health and confidence, I know how powerful these treatments can be when approached the right way. We want every client to feel heard, understood, and empowered.”

Dr Ahmed Riaz, a specialist in hair loss and transplants, also practices from the clinic.
The clinic offers a range of popular treatments including anti-wrinkle injections, skin boosters, chemical peels, microneedling, dermal fillers and the latest in bio-remodelling using polynucleotide technology to stimulate collagen and elastin production.
Clients also have access to Obagi, a luxury, science-led skincare line.
Forward Property Group’s Crown Passages is a mixed-use development facing on to the Sainsbury's car park in Hale village.
Dr. Caroline Warden Aesthetics joins the existing tenants which include Luxury Items Ltd, Starlight Ultrasound, Mulan Bar and Aspire Gym.
